Events2Join

Should hibernate use unique sequences for each table?


Should hibernate use unique sequences for each table?

I tend to keep distinct sequences for closely related tables (ie. class hierarchies, if any, mapped using JOINED table strategy) but that's because, like you, ...

[Feature Request] PostgreSQL: Unique Sequence for each entity

Using sequences in Hibernate is better because it can provision a batch of new ids in one statement and then use them for many inserts without ...

mysql - hibernate creating empty table - hibernate_sequence at startup

The sequence table is because of how you've defined the primary key on one/all of your entities.

why the single hibernate oracle sequence - JBoss.org

Why does the hibernate only use the single oracle database sequence? We tend to use a separate sequence for every table unless we need to have ...

Hibernate Community • View topic - Using one sequence per table

The rules in Oracle are 1 sequence per table because if you drop a table and populate it after you can have a hole in your sequence of several ...

How to use Hibernate identifier sequence generators properly

Although convenient, and even suggested in many PostgreSQL book, the SERIAL and BIGSERIAL column types are not a very good choice when using JPA ...

How do Identity, Sequence, and Table (sequence-like) generators ...

Aside from disabling JDBC batching, the IDENTITY generator strategy doesn't work with the TABLE_PER_CLASS inheritance model because there could ...

An Overview of Identifiers in Hibernate/JPA - Baeldung

SEQUENCE is the generation type recommended by the Hibernate documentation. The generated values are unique per sequence. If we don't specify a ...

Hibernate Tips: How to use a custom database sequence

First of all, you have to annotate the primary key attribute with the @GeneratedValue annotation and set GenerationType.SEQUENCE as the strategy.

ID generation with ORM's Table, Sequence or Identity strategy

Applications have to remember to use the correct sequence to insert the data in the table, hibernate mapping is somewhat verbose. Other ...

Why you should never use the TABLE identifier generator with JPA ...

While IDENTITY maps to an auto-incremented column (e.g. IDENTITY in SQL Server or AUTO_INCREMENT in MySQL) and SEQUENCE is used for delegating ...

Hibernate 6 sequece maybe not working as expected

From my POV, you can continue using the “hibernate_sequence” approach or the table per sequence approach. Transactions on the table are very ...

Generate Primary Keys Using JPA and Hibernate - Thorben Janssen

It simulates a sequence by storing and updating its current value in a database table which requires the use of pessimistic locks which put all transactions ...

hibernate_sequence w/ spring boot 3 : r/javahelp - Reddit

You could replace animal_SEQ with whatever the default hibernate sequence is. ... use the default sequence anymore, as you correctly stated.

Why is Hibernate creating a unique constraint when I don't want one?

You can also define unique constraints to the table using the @UniqueConstraint annotation in conjunction with @Table (for a unique constraint ...

Chapter 6. Identifiers

UNIQUE - The values must uniquely identify each row. ... The basic idea is that a given table-generator table ( hibernate_sequences for example) can hold multiple ...

JPA, Hibernate: Custom primary key generator, before persist

It's barcode must be unique, it must associate that document to it's ... A sequences table thing. I'm sure I've seen something along those lines ...

GeneratedValue to generate globalIndex in domainEventEntry table ...

Greetings! Yes I have solved this problem. I presume you also must be using spring jpa and hibernate. ... hibernate-sequence-naming-strategies.

Hibernate - @GeneratedValue Annotation in JPA - GeeksforGeeks

GenerationType.TABLE: This strategy uses a separate database table to generate primary key values. The persistence provider manages this table ...

How to Implement a Custom, Sequence-Based ID Generator

Today I will show you how you can Implement a Custom, Sequence-Based ID Generator with #Hibernate. A lot of applications use primary keys ...